Polypropylene is a valuable, versatile plastic from the polyolefin family, known for its durability, crack-resistance and potential to be microwaved. Products made from polypropylene are marked by a “5” within a solid triangle – its resin identification code. This is usually found on or near the bottom of the product.
Polypropylene starts as a liquid monomer. It’s polymerized, making it a stable, solid polymer that is manufactured by extrusion, thermoforming or injection molding.
Extrusion
forces melted plastic through a mold before the plastic is cooled.
Thermoforming
requires laying an extruded sheet of plastic over a mold. Then heat and suction are used to form the plastic into the shape of the mold. Once shaped, these sheets are cooled and trimmed to create the finished product.
Injection molding
is similar to extrusion; however, rather than forcing melted plastic through a mold, the plastic is forced into a mold cavity. The product is then cooled, ejected from the mold and trimmed.
RECOVERING & RECYCLING POLYPROPYLENE
Clear, thermoformed polypropylene without ink or labels is accepted for recycling throughout most of the US and Canada. Packaging that is less than 2”x2”x2” or black in color is unlikely to be recovered at typical sorting facilities.
For the most accurate information, we recommend checking with your local municipality or waste hauler to see if polypropylene is accepted in your community’s recycling program. You may also search for polypropylene recycling by zip code at Earth911.
